
Nuclear Player s'est taillé une place de choix parmi les lecteurs de musique modernes en combinant le meilleur du streaming en ligne avec la philosophie du logiciel libre. C'est un programme conçu pour ceux qui veulent Écoutez de la musique sans publicité, sans suivi et en toute liberté. Cela correspond à ce que l'on entend, d'après de multiples sources et sur n'importe quel système d'exploitation de bureau.
Dans cet article, nous examinerons en détail Nuclear Player : ses fonctionnalités, le fonctionnement de son système de plugins, les plateformes sur lesquelles il est disponible, ses particularités par rapport aux autres lecteurs et les raisons de son succès auprès des utilisateurs et des développeurs. Toutes ces informations seront présentées de manière claire et accessible pour une compréhension optimale. un aperçu complet de ce que vous pouvez faire avec ce lecteur de musique gratuit et open source.
Qu'est-ce que Nuclear Player et qu'est-ce qui le différencie des autres ?
Nuclear Player est un lecteur de musique gratuit et open source Nuclear se distingue par plusieurs atouts majeurs : l’application est sans publicité, ne collecte aucune donnée personnelle et ne suit pas votre activité. Elle utilise de multiples sources en ligne pour diffuser les morceaux. Au lieu d’être limitée à votre bibliothèque musicale locale ou à une seule plateforme, Nuclear vous permet de rechercher des titres et des artistes sur différents services, de créer des playlists et d’écouter quasiment tout ce que vous trouvez.
L'objectif principal du projet est d'offrir une expérience d'écoute simple et puissante qui respecte votre vie privéeVous ne trouverez ni recommandations intrusives, ni publicités intégrées, ni algorithmes analysant votre comportement pour vous proposer du contenu. Ce qui s'affiche à l'écran dépend principalement de la popularité des morceaux au sein de l'écosystème Nuclear et de vos favoris.
De plus, étant un logiciel libre, chacun peut examiner son code, contribuer à l'ajout de nouvelles fonctionnalités ou créer des extensions. Cette philosophie ouverte est particulièrement visible dans son système de plugins, qui est devenu le cœur du joueurpuisque pratiquement toutes les fonctions passent par eux.
Plateformes et formats disponibles
L'un des principaux avantages de Nuclear Player est sa compatibilité multiplateforme. Le projet propose des versions pour Windows, macOS et LinuxVous pouvez donc utiliser le même lecteur sur presque tous les ordinateurs de bureau modernes sans aucun problème.
Sous Windows, Nuclear est distribué dans Le programme d'installation est disponible au format .exe et également sous forme de package .msi.Cela vous permet de choisir le type d'installation qui correspond le mieux à vos besoins. Les deux formats facilitent une procédure d'installation standard, avec intégration système et création de raccourcis.
Sur macOS, le lecteur est disponible dans Image .dmg compatible avec les processeurs Apple Silicon et IntelCela signifie que vous pouvez utiliser Nuclear sur les ordinateurs Mac récents équipés de puces M1, M2 et de leurs successeurs, ainsi que sur les modèles plus anciens dotés d'une architecture x86, en tirant parti des optimisations de chaque plateforme.
Dans l'écosystème Linux, où la variété des distributions est énorme, Nuclear offre plusieurs options afin que chaque utilisateur puisse Installez le programme dans le format qui convient le mieux à votre système.Le lecteur peut être téléchargé à l'adresse suivante : sur GitHub como AppImage, .deb, .rpm et également au format FlatpakCela couvre les distributions allant de Debian et Ubuntu à Fedora, openSUSE et bien d'autres, en plus de la possibilité d'utiliser un conteneur Flatpak indépendant de la distribution.
Une interface moderne et familière
Nuclear Player parie sur un Une interface moderne et épurée, très similaire à celle des principales plateformes de streaming.Si vous avez l'habitude de services comme Spotify ou Deezer ou autres lecteurs multimédiasL'organisation de l'écran principal vous semblera très intuitive, avec des sections dédiées aux playlists populaires, aux artistes en vedette et aux albums les plus écoutés.
Lorsque vous ouvrirez l'application, vous serez accueilli playlists populaires, artistes et albums les plus écoutés dans votre paysVous bénéficiez également d'un accès rapide à vos propres collections. Cette structure vous permet de commencer à écouter de la musique dès votre connexion, sans avoir à naviguer dans des menus complexes.
L'application comporte des sections pour Vos playlists créées, vos chansons préférées, ainsi que vos artistes et albums favoris.Pour marquer un élément comme favori, il suffit de cliquer sur « J’aime », et ce morceau, artiste ou album deviendra disponible dans ses sections correspondantes, à l’instar des services de streaming commerciaux.
Le tout est soutenu par une conception visuelle soignée, avec de grandes couvertures, un texte lisible et une navigation aisée grâce aux raccourcis clavier et souris. L'objectif est que le joueur soit Son utilisation quotidienne est agréable, et trouver ce que l'on souhaite écouter ne prend que quelques clics..
Fonctions principales pour l'écoute de la musique
Le cœur de Nuclear Player réside dans sa capacité à rechercher et écouter de la musique provenant de diverses sources en ligneElle ne se limite pas à une seule bibliothèque : vous pouvez trouver des chansons, des albums et des artistes sur différents services et les écouter sans quitter l’application.
À partir de la barre de recherche, vous pouvez Saisissez un titre de chanson, un nom d'artiste ou un titre d'album, et Nuclear vous affichera les résultats. Les sons proviennent de sources configurées via des plugins. Une fois le thème choisi, vous pouvez sélectionner parmi plusieurs sources disponibles celle qui vous convient le mieux ou celle offrant la meilleure qualité sonore du moment.
Le joueur propose un système de queue très complet, avec Mélanger, répéter et réorganiser les options par glisser-déposerVous pouvez ajouter des morceaux à la file d'attente, voir quel titre sera joué ensuite et modifier l'ordre à tout moment. Ainsi, vous pouvez facilement improviser des sessions d'écoute sans avoir à créer une playlist formelle à chaque fois.
De plus, Nuclear vous permet de Explorez les pages d'artistes spécifiques avec leurs biographies, discographies et artistes similaires.Ainsi, vous écoutez de la musique, mais vous découvrez aussi le contexte et les liens entre différents groupes et artistes solo. De même, chaque page d'album affiche la liste complète des titres, avec un accès rapide à la lecture et à la gestion dans la file d'attente ou vos listes de lecture.
Les utilisateurs plus curieux peuvent parcourir Nouveautés, titres les plus populaires et playlists sélectionnées par la rédactionCes sections vous aident à découvrir de nouvelles musiques sans dépendre d'algorithmes basés sur votre comportement, ce qui permet au projet de privilégier la transparence et l'absence de suivi.
Système de listes de lecture et de favoris
L'un des points forts de Nuclear Player est son Gestion flexible des listes de lecture et des favorisVous disposez d'outils pour créer vos propres listes à partir de zéro, modifier leur contenu et leur ordre, ainsi que pour importer et exporter des collections provenant d'autres services.
Le joueur permet Créez des listes de lecture personnalisées, importez-les depuis différentes plateformes et exportez-les pour les utiliser dans d'autres programmes.De plus, il permet d'importer des contenus depuis des services populaires comme Spotify, Deezer ou YouTube, ce qui est particulièrement utile si vous avez déjà des playlists bien établies et que vous ne souhaitez pas repartir de zéro.
La section des favoris est organisée autour trois types d'éléments : chansons, artistes et albumsChaque fois que vous indiquez qu'un morceau vous plaît, il est déplacé vers la section correspondante. Cela crée une sorte de bibliothèque rapide à laquelle vous pouvez accéder lorsque vous n'avez pas envie de chercher quelque chose de précis et que vous souhaitez simplement écouter des morceaux que vous savez de qualité.
Lorsque vous lancez une seule chanson, le lecteur peut créer une sorte de « radio » basée sur ce thème, en mélangeant des morceaux similaires pour créer une expérience d'écoute fluide sans que vous ayez à ajouter manuellement chaque chanson.
Télécharger de la musique MP3 à partir de diverses sources
Contrairement à d'autres plateformes axées uniquement sur le streaming, Nuclear Player offre la possibilité de Téléchargez des chansons au format MP3 pour les enregistrer localement.Cette fonction repose également sur des sources de contenu configurées via des plugins ; vous choisissez donc d’où provient chaque morceau.
Lorsque vous trouvez une chanson dans la recherche, vous pouvez Choisissez la source de téléchargement et enregistrez le fichier dans le dossier de votre choix.Vous constituez ainsi votre propre bibliothèque locale avec les chansons que vous écoutez le plus, et vous les gardez disponibles même sans connexion internet.
Il est important de noter que le La qualité audio peut varier en fonction de la source choisie.C’est pourquoi Nuclear propose plusieurs options pour une même chanson, afin que vous puissiez choisir la version qui offre le meilleur son ou celle qui vous intéresse pour une autre raison.
La gestion de ces téléchargements coexiste avec la lecture en continu, vous permettant de Combinez des morceaux en ligne avec la musique stockée sur votre propre PCLe lecteur fait donc office à la fois de client de streaming unifié et de bibliothèque locale.
Affichage des paroles de la chanson
Nuclear Player intègre une section dédiée aux paroles, à l'instar d'autres lecteurs modernes. Lorsque vous lancez un morceau, le programme tente de… Trouvez les paroles sur des sites en ligne comme AZLyrics. et l'afficher automatiquement s'il est disponible.
Cette fonctionnalité est particulièrement utile si vous aimez Suivez la chanson au fur et à mesure qu'elle joue, apprenez les paroles ou recherchez des passages spécifiques.L'ensemble du processus est transparent pour l'utilisateur : si une lettre est associée, elle apparaîtra sans que vous ayez à faire quoi que ce soit d'autre.
Grâce à l'intégration directe dans le lecteur, vous n'avez plus besoin d'ouvrir votre navigateur ni de rechercher les paroles manuellement. Nuclear s'en charge. Consultez les services concernés et associez les paroles à la chanson que vous écoutez.à condition qu'une correspondance existe dans la base de données utilisée.
Confidentialité : Aucune publicité ni suivi
L'une des caractéristiques déterminantes de Nuclear Player est son engagement pour une expérience sans publicité ni suiviLe programme n'inclut ni bannières, ni publicités audio, ni modules de suivi qui enregistrent votre comportement musical à des fins commerciales.
Cette philosophie pourrait particulièrement séduire ceux qui sont lassés du flot incessant de recommandations et de publicités automatisées sur les principales plateformes. Avec Nuclear, vous conservez un meilleur contrôle sur ce que vous entendez et les données que vous générezcar le programme ne cherche pas à établir votre profil ni à vous afficher de publicités ciblées.
Thèmes visuels et personnalisation de l'apparence
Pour satisfaire tous les goûts, Nuclear Player inclut plusieurs thèmes visuels intégrés en standardVous pouvez passer de l'un à l'autre pour modifier l'apparence générale de l'interface, en jouant avec les couleurs, les arrière-plans et les détails graphiques.
Outre les thèmes préinstallés, le lecteur permet Utilisez des thèmes personnalisés via CSSCela ouvre la porte à une personnalisation très poussée, conçue pour les utilisateurs avancés qui souhaitent peaufiner le design au millimètre près ou créer des styles entièrement nouveaux.
L'idée est que vous n'êtes pas obligé d'utiliser systématiquement le même style. Si vous aimez personnaliser l'apparence de vos applications, Nuclear offre une base solide avec des thèmes prêts à l'emploi et la possibilité de télécharger vos propres feuilles de style pour personnaliser le lecteur à votre goût.
Système de plugins : le cœur de Nuclear
Dans ses versions récentes, Nuclear est devenu fortement dépendant d'un un système de plugins puissant qui décrit pratiquement toutes ses fonctionsL'architecture du lecteur a été repensée afin que la plupart des fonctionnalités soient implémentées sous forme d'extensions, ce qui rend le programme très modulaire.
Les plugins peuvent contribuer sources de streaming, fournisseurs de métadonnées, gestionnaires de listes de lecture, contenu du tableau de bord principal et bien d'autres fonctionnalitésAinsi, par exemple, un plugin peut se connecter à un service spécifique pour proposer des chansons, tandis qu'un autre est chargé de récupérer les informations sur les artistes ou d'élaborer des recommandations éditoriales.
Au sein même de l'application, il y a une boutique de plugins intégrée Depuis Nuclear, vous pouvez rechercher, installer, activer ou désactiver des extensions sans quitter le programme. Cette approche transforme le lecteur en une plateforme extensible, où la communauté peut ajouter de nouvelles fonctionnalités sans modifier le cœur du programme.
Pour ceux qui souhaitent développer leurs propres extensions, le projet offre SDK @nuclearplayer/plugin-sdkCe kit de développement fournit les outils nécessaires pour créer des plugins compatibles, les intégrer correctement et tirer parti des capacités internes du lecteur.
Intégration avec des agents d'IA via MCP
L'une des innovations les plus marquantes de Nuclear Player est son Serveur MCP, qui permet aux agents d'intelligence artificielle de contrôler le joueurEn activant cette fonction dans le menu des paramètres, dans la section intégrations, une interface est activée, conçue pour permettre aux applications d'IA de communiquer avec Nuclear.
Ce serveur MCP est conçu pour être facile à découvrir par les clients compatiblesIl existe même une « compétence » spécifique appelée compétence MCP nucléaire qui aide les agents IA à comprendre plus rapidement comment interagir avec le joueur.
L'écosystème de développement mentionne l'intégration avec des outils tels que Claude Code via Codex CLI, OpenCode et les environnements de bureau tels que Claude Desktop, Cursor ou WindsurfGrâce à ce système, un assistant IA peut, par exemple, rechercher des chansons, manipuler la file d'attente de lecture ou gérer des listes de lecture pour votre compte, toujours sous votre contrôle.
Raccourcis clavier, mises à jour et traductions
Pour améliorer l'utilisation au quotidien, Nuclear Player inclut Raccourcis clavier configurés pour les actions les plus courantesCela vous permet de contrôler la lecture, de passer des pistes, de rechercher des chansons ou de gérer la file d'attente sans avoir à utiliser constamment la souris.
Le projet intègre également un système de mise à jour automatiqueAinsi, vous bénéficiez des nouvelles versions et des améliorations sans avoir à télécharger manuellement chaque mise à jour. Lorsqu'une nouvelle version stable est disponible, le lecteur gère automatiquement la mise à jour.
En ce qui concerne la langue, Nuclear est situé traduit en plusieurs langues, ce qui facilite son utilisation dans différentes régionsCette localisation rend les menus, les messages et les options plus compréhensibles pour les utilisateurs qui ne parlent pas anglais, élargissant ainsi la portée du joueur à une communauté internationale.
Architecture technique et exigences pour les développeurs
Derrière l'interface soignée et toutes ces fonctionnalités se cache une infrastructure technique assez complexe. Le nucléaire est organisé comme un dépôt unique géré avec pnpm et TurborepoCela signifie que le code des différents packages liés au projet est conservé dans un seul dépôt bien structuré.
L'application principale est construite avec Tauri, qui combine Rust dans la partie native avec React dans l'interface webCe choix technologique permet la création d'une application de bureau relativement légère et sécurisée, tirant parti de l'efficacité de Rust et de la flexibilité de React pour la couche visuelle.
Pour ceux qui souhaitent compiler ou développer Nuclear à partir du code source, il est nécessaire d'avoir Node.js version 22 ou supérieure, pnpm version 9 ou supérieure et Rust sur son canal stable, en plus des dépendances Tauri spécifiques à chaque plateforme, telles que documentées dans le guide officiel de ce framework.
Le dépôt décrit divers tâches de travail courantes dans l'espace de développementCes opérations sont exécutées à la racine du projet à l'aide des outils pnpm et Turborepo. Cela simplifie la gestion des différents paquets et modules qui composent l'écosystème Nuclear.
Concernant la licence, le projet est distribué sous AGPL-3.0, une licence copyleft forteCe choix exige que les modifications et les dérivés distribués publiquement conservent le même type de licence, renforçant ainsi le caractère libre et ouvert de l'application.
Nuclear Player pour utilisateurs d'ordinateurs de bureau
Du point de vue de l'utilisateur final, Nuclear Player se présente comme Une solution très intéressante pour écouter de la musique gratuitement sur les ordinateurs fonctionnant sous Windows, macOS et Linux.Leur offre combine la lecture à partir de plusieurs services en ligne, la possibilité de télécharger des morceaux au format MP3, une gestion avancée des listes de lecture et une interface similaire à celle des principaux services commerciaux.
Le fait du pouvoir Mélangez des chansons provenant de différentes plateformes avec votre musique stockée localement. Il élargit considérablement les possibilités par rapport à un lecteur traditionnel. Concrètement, vous pouvez centraliser les morceaux enregistrés sur votre ordinateur, ceux provenant de diverses sources en ligne et les listes de lecture importées d'autres applications.
Pour toutes ces raisons, Nuclear est particulièrement intéressant pour ceux qui recherchent un lecteur unifié qui n'est pas lié à une seule plateforme de streamingqui respecte la vie privée et offre également des options de personnalisation avancées, tant visuelles que fonctionnelles, grâce à des plugins.
En définitive, Nuclear Player se positionne comme un lecteur de musique complet, flexible et convivial, capable de rivaliser avec de nombreuses solutions commerciales grâce à ses fonctionnalités, tout en étant gratuit et open source. Pour quiconque souhaite centraliser sa musique, expérimenter des intégrations avancées ou simplement écouter des morceaux sans publicité ni suivi, il devient… une alternative très solide avec un fort potentiel de croissance.